The top recruiters for the SOM, BML Munjal University placements are given below:

SOM, BML Munjal University Top Recruiters

Amazon

Hero

KPMG

Federal Bank

TVS

Hyundai

Accenture

Wipro

Axis Bank

The School of Management, BML Munjal University offers decent packages to the MBA graduates placing them in leading companies and has a wide career scope. Check out the table below to know more about the highest packages offered at SOM, BML Munjal University placements for the year 2022-24:

Particulars 

Placement Statistics (2022)

Placement Statistics (2023)

Placement Statistics (2024)

the highest Package

INR 32.21 LPA 

INR 25.9 LPA

INR 14.71 LPA

Top 25% Package

INR 12.8 LPA

INR 11.4 LPA

INR 12.5 LPA

Average Package

INR 8.77 LPA 

INR 9.38 LPA 

INR 9.20 LPA

Placement Rate

98.7%

97.59%

95.8%

Career readiness starts during year one with Practice School I. Students start to understand and immerse themselves in the industry and the culture of the working world. Courses like "The Joy of Engineering" are designed to stimulate problem-solving and team-building activities early on.

As students continue, Practice School II and III provide additional hands-on experiences through internships and full-semester projects, ranking them for pre-placement offers to various employers. After completing the programme, the Career Guidance and Development Cell (CGDC) supports placements with top recruiters like Commvault Systems, Deloitte, Hero
